-
Notifications
You must be signed in to change notification settings - Fork 5.8k
Closed
Labels
PFCCPaddle Framework Contributor Club,https://github.com/PaddlePaddle/community/tree/master/pfccPaddle Framework Contributor Club,https://github.com/PaddlePaddle/community/tree/master/pfccstatus/close已关闭已关闭
Description
问题描述 Please describe your issue
一、Background 🎃
- 飞桨新 IR 项目整体背景,详见:🎉 Paddle 之艾尔登(IR Dialect)快乐勇士挑战赛 ⚔ #55205
- 如果你是在校的学生,并且有兴趣参加飞桨社区的框架护航项目,非常欢迎你依据这份材料来申请:百度飞桨框架护航计划。
飞桨框架自2.5版本开始重构旧的Program IR体系,孵化编译器友好、高度灵活和易扩展性的新一代 IR 体系,有力支撑基础框架训练、推理、编译器、分布式、科学计算等领域。
新一代 IR 体系的重构升级对于用户是透明无感的,得益于前端Python API、自动微分核心组件的无缝升级切换,故此课题主要内容包括:
- 飞桨Python端全量API 静态图分支的切换新 IR 体系并下沉C++
- 基于Python API的自动微分机制全量验证
- API 和自动微分推全时依赖的核心组件、功能机制的迭代完善
二、Tasks 📚
☀️ 热身工作
序号 | 模块 | 功能描述 | PR | 贡献者 |
---|---|---|---|---|
1.1 | PIR 迁移 | paddle.Tensor.round | #58005 ✅ | @MarioLulab |
1.2 | PIR 迁移 | paddle.Tensor.sin | #58094 ✅ | @MarioLulab |
1.3 | PIR 迁移 | paddle.Tensor.cos | #58137 ✅ | @MarioLulab |
1.4 | PIR 迁移 | paddle.Tensor.dot | #57990 ✅ #58081 ✅ |
@MarioLulab |
1.5 | PIR 迁移 | paddle.Tensor.floor | #58093 ✅ | @MarioLulab |
1.6 | PIR 迁移 | paddle.nn.Sigmoid | #58144 ✅ | @MarioLulab |
1.7 | PIR 迁移 | paddle.nn.LeakyReLU | #58340 ✅ | @MarioLulab |
1.8 | PIR 迁移 | paddle.nn.MSELoss | #58352 ✅ | @MarioLulab |
1.9 | PIR 迁移 | paddle.Tensor.log10 | #58363 ✅ | @MarioLulab |
☎️ 技术串讲
序号 | 串讲主题 | 时间 | 贡献者 |
---|---|---|---|
2.1 | xxx | xxx | @MarioLulab |
🔧 功能机制
序号 | 模块 | 功能描述 | PR | 贡献者 |
---|---|---|---|---|
3.1 | xxx | xxx | xxx | @MarioLulab |
📄任务发布
序号 | 任务主题 | 时间 | 发布者 |
---|---|---|---|
4.1 | 【Hackathon】新IR Python API适配升级 | 10.24 正式发布 | @MarioLulab |
三、Meetings 💼
每周二、周五答疑例会
日期 | 答疑问题汇总 | 参会人 |
---|---|---|
xxx | 会议纪要 | xxx |
Aurelius84Aurelius84
Metadata
Metadata
Assignees
Labels
PFCCPaddle Framework Contributor Club,https://github.com/PaddlePaddle/community/tree/master/pfccPaddle Framework Contributor Club,https://github.com/PaddlePaddle/community/tree/master/pfccstatus/close已关闭已关闭